The Beginning of the End
The trailer opens in the fall of 1987. Hawkins, once an ordinary small town, now feels like a battleground caught between two worlds. After the events of Season 4, the Upside Down has literally torn through the town’s fabric. Military forces have locked down the area, residents are living under constant surveillance, and the haunting presence of Vecna lingers over everything.
Series co-creator Ross Duffer describes this season as a direct continuation of that chaos. “We usually start by re-establishing normal life before diving into the supernatural,” he told Tudum. “But this time, the show sprints from the start.”
That shift in pacing is felt instantly. The once-slow burn of Stranger Things now ignites like a full-blown inferno. The stakes are high, the tone darker, and the sense of urgency unmistakable.

Where Each Character Stands
Season 5 doesn’t reset anyone’s story; it continues directly from the heartbreak of Season 4.
- Max (Sadie Sink) is still recovering from her near-fatal encounter with Vecna. The trailer suggests she remains trapped between life and death, with Eleven trying to reach her. That glimmer of hope might just be the emotional heartbeat of the season.
- Lucas (Caleb McLaughlin) struggles with the burden of keeping the group together while watching his friends, and town, crumble around him.
- Will Byers (Noah Schnapp) returns to Hawkins, facing the psychic connection that once tied him to the Upside Down. As the anniversary of his disappearance approaches, the trailer hints that Will may play a critical role in closing the story’s full circle.
- Jonathan (Charlie Heaton) and Nancy (Natalia Dyer) are back in investigative mode, hunting for Vecna’s next move, while Steve (Joe Keery) and Robin (Maya Hawke) bring both courage and comic relief to the otherwise grim narrative.
The ensemble feels tighter than ever, as if the series has saved its purest teamwork moment for last.
The Rise and Return of Vecna
Few TV villains have left a mark like Jamie Campbell Bower’s Vecna. The trailer shows glimpses of him rebuilding his physical form, darker, angrier, and more menacing than before. His absence since the Season 4 finale only adds to the anticipation.
The official synopsis reveals that Vecna’s whereabouts remain unknown when the season begins. But his influence is everywhere, from the twisted landscapes of Hawkins to the nightmares invading Eleven’s mind. Fans can expect a more personal confrontation between him and the heroes, especially Eleven and Will, both of whom share deep psychic links to the Upside Down.
If Season 4 made Vecna terrifying, Season 5 promises to make him mythic.
Three Volumes, One Farewell
Netflix has announced that Stranger Things 5 will release in three parts, a structure that gives fans time to savor the final journey.
- Volume 1: November 26, 2025
- Volume 2: December 25, 2025
- Final Episode: December 31, 2025
With this schedule, the story will unfold through the holiday season, an emotional gift and farewell for audiences who’ve been with the show since its 2016 debut.
